Heated Hoses - Type ELH/a Up To 250°C
Transportation of gas substances from the measurement point (i.e.chimney, connection on a heated measurement probe) to the analysis measurement unit e.g. mass spectrometer, gas chromatograph etc. Installed in a system or as transportable device (i.e. exhaust measurement unit).

Background of the application:
- Condensation is not allowed to build up in gas. This would cause sedimentation and clogging inside the analysis line, acidification drops are built.
- Differences in the gas temperatures on the way to the analyzer can cause inaccurate values
- Prevention of dropping below the dew point, especially by exhaust of gases. The dew point of the fossil fuel is between 100°C and 190°C, depending on the sulfur content.
Application:
- Coal, oil and gas heating units
- Exhaust supervision in power supply stations
- Trash burning stations
- Process gases in refineries, petro-chemical and chemical industry
- Air condition monitoring
- Motor exhaust measurement
- Freeze protection in the water analysis
Various Designs:
- ELH/a: With a fixed inner hose of PTFE
- ELH/ad:With a fixed inner hose of PTFE, steel wire braiding and RSL fittings on both sides
- ELH/ak: With a fixed copper inner hose
- ELH/ae: With a fixed stainless steel inner hose

Type ELH/a Up To 250°C
| TECHNICAL DATA | |
| Heating power | 10 bis 250 W/m |
| Max. length | 0.3 bis 100m |
| Nominal diameter | 4 bis 16 mm |
| Operating temperatures | max. 250°C (higher temperatures upon request) |
| Nominal voltage | 24 V, 110 V 230 V, 400 V |
| Temperature sensor | PT 100, thermocouples |
